mirror of
https://gitee.com/y_project/RuoYi-Cloud.git
synced 2026-01-26 11:51:55 +08:00
[feat] SysUser返回第三方平台id用以判断是否绑定
This commit is contained in:
@@ -5,7 +5,7 @@
|
||||
<parent>
|
||||
<groupId>com.ruoyi</groupId>
|
||||
<artifactId>ruoyi-api</artifactId>
|
||||
<version>3.6.5.0.1</version>
|
||||
<version>3.6.5.0.2</version>
|
||||
</parent>
|
||||
<modelVersion>4.0.0</modelVersion>
|
||||
|
||||
|
||||
@@ -77,6 +77,12 @@ public class SysUser extends BaseEntity
|
||||
})
|
||||
private SysDept dept;
|
||||
|
||||
/** 部门对象 */
|
||||
@Excels({
|
||||
@Excel(name = "微信UnionId", targetAttr = "wxUnionId", type = Type.EXPORT)
|
||||
})
|
||||
private KSysUserAccount sysUserAccount;
|
||||
|
||||
/** 角色对象 */
|
||||
private List<SysRole> roles;
|
||||
|
||||
@@ -257,6 +263,14 @@ public class SysUser extends BaseEntity
|
||||
this.dept = dept;
|
||||
}
|
||||
|
||||
public KSysUserAccount getSysUserAccount() {
|
||||
return sysUserAccount;
|
||||
}
|
||||
|
||||
public void setSysUserAccount(KSysUserAccount sysUserAccount) {
|
||||
this.sysUserAccount = sysUserAccount;
|
||||
}
|
||||
|
||||
public List<SysRole> getRoles()
|
||||
{
|
||||
return roles;
|
||||
@@ -318,6 +332,7 @@ public class SysUser extends BaseEntity
|
||||
.append("updateTime", getUpdateTime())
|
||||
.append("remark", getRemark())
|
||||
.append("dept", getDept())
|
||||
.append("userAccount", getSysUserAccount())
|
||||
.toString();
|
||||
}
|
||||
}
|
||||
|
||||
@@ -0,0 +1,9 @@
|
||||
package com.ruoyi.system.api.domain
|
||||
|
||||
class KSysUserAccount {
|
||||
/** 用户ID */
|
||||
var userId: Long? = null
|
||||
|
||||
/** 微信UnionId */
|
||||
var wxUnionId: String? = null
|
||||
}
|
||||
Reference in New Issue
Block a user